J-REX 09-15-2003, 02:04 PM Just wanted to let everyone know that I dropped the JIC Magic Bullet 505s full titanium catback on my STI and wow! It fits up perfect to my Turboxs downpipe and midpipe. If you are thinking about doing this yourself then you will need a couple bolts to connect it since it doesn't come with a hardware kit and the stock bolts suck. Instead of using a donut gasket you should probably find yourself a 3" flat aluminum gasket. The easiest way to find one may be on the internet since I had a really hard time finding one.
If you keep the silencer in the muffler it sounds nearly stock. My ears couldn't really tell the difference. But when I pulled the silencer out the the sound came alive. It brought out that really boxer noise. Not too loud like I had heard it was going to be on the 2.5. I'm stoked so I just thought I'd tell everyone. I get a little backfire when I shift at low RPM's but with no cats and no back pressure it's to be expected. Besides, once you learn how to control it and do it when you want, it's fun to make people duck and run for cover.

J-REX 09-16-2003, 08:48 AM STILL-
Ya I still have a CEL. Had it checked out by my friendly neighborhood Subaru dealer. I'm in good with those guys. It just thows the P-Code for catalytic converter inefficiency. Bad thing about getting a CEL on the STI is that it deactivates the cruise control. I wrote a whole thread on it. Read the post just below the pic of the DP.
